About this book

Old Testament

ExodusDeliverance, covenant, presence. A slave-people redeemed from Egypt, brought to Sinai, and given a tabernacle so that God might dwell among them.

Author
Moses — traditional attribution; internal narrator identifies Moses as recorder (17:14, 24:4, 34:27)
Date
15th or 13th century BC, depending on chronology of the exodus
